What to Expect on the Trip

A boat trip from Lombok to Komodo National Park typically takes several days, ranging from 3 to 5 days, depending on the itinerary. The journey includes multiple stops at spectacular islands, snorkeling spots, and hidden beaches. Some of the highlights of this trip include:

1. Exploring Komodo National Park

One of the main attractions of this trip is visiting Komodo National Park, which consists of Komodo Island, Rinca Island, and Padar Island. Here, travelers can witness the majestic Komodo dragons in their natural habitat. Guided tours ensure safety while providing in-depth knowledge about these ancient creatures.

2. Snorkeling and Diving in Pristine Waters

The waters around Komodo National Park are home to some of the best snorkeling and diving spots in the world. Popular locations include Pink Beach, Manta Point, and Kanawa Island. These sites offer vibrant coral reefs, diverse marine life, and the chance to swim with manta rays and sea turtles.

3. Padar Island: A Stunning Panoramic View

Padar Island is famous for its breathtaking viewpoint, offering a panoramic view of three differently colored beaches—white, pink, and black. The short but steep hike to the top is well worth the effort, as it provides one of the most picturesque landscapes in Indonesia.

4. Relaxing on Secluded Beaches

Throughout the journey, travelers can enjoy relaxing on untouched beaches, sunbathing on the deck, or simply soaking in the beauty of the surrounding islands. Some boats even provide kayak or paddleboard options for added adventure.

Best Time to Visit

The best time for a Komodo Boat Trip from Lombok is during the dry season, from April to October. This period offers calm seas, clear skies, and excellent visibility for snorkeling and diving. However, trips are available year-round, with each season offering a unique experience.

Choosing the Right Boat Trip

There are various options for boat trips, ranging from budget-friendly shared boats to luxurious private charters. When choosing a tour, consider factors such as boat facilities, safety measures, itinerary, and reviews from previous travelers. Some boats offer cabin accommodations, while others provide open-deck sleeping arrangements under the stars.
